Known for their larger size, rich salinity, and dense, meaty texture, these clams offer a bold bite and a classic taste of the Atlantic. Their palm-sized, hard shells encase firm, juicy meat that delivers the perfect balance of briny, slightly sweet flavor with a satisfying chew.
Sitting between littlenecks and quahogs in size, Cherrystones are wonderfully versatile—large enough to stand up to heat, yet tender enough to enjoy raw. Whether you’re preparing a pot of New England clam chowder, a tray of clams casino, or stuffing them with herbed breadcrumbs for classic baked clams, these mollusks bring flavor and texture that hold their own in any recipe.
